Henna Body Art Course Overview

Our Henna Body Art (Mehndi) course will teach you how to apply temporary ‘tattoos' using natural henna and how to decorate the designs with body paints and bindis (body jewels.)

Using a stencil you will be taught how to apply henna paste to the skin and produce a fabulous design. For those of you who prefer to create your own designs and effects, you will also learn freehand application, using a cone applicator (just like a mini icing bag,) filled with henna paste. You can make your design as simple or intricate as you desire - let your imagination run wild!

Because the ‘tattoo' is temporary, once it has faded, you can start again and create a totally new design!

Henna Body Art (Mehndi) Training Course Content

  • Safety
  • Consultations
  • Contr-indications
  • Product description and storage
  • Skin preparation
  • Product preparation
  • Application
  • Removal and aftercare
  • Mehndi designs
